I never get tired of this place—it’s become my go-to weekend ritual. Every Saturday morning, you’ll find me out front, with a bagel in hand. There’s just something special about it—the energy, the food, the people.

The staff is incredibly kind, and it’s obvious how hard they work. There are only a handful of them running the show, yet they manage to keep things moving smoothly even when the line stretches out the door (which it often does!). Despite the rush, they never make you feel rushed.

If you’re not sure what to order, don’t be shy—ask for recommendations. They’ve truly seen it all, and somehow always know exactly what to suggest. That’s actually how I discovered my now-favorite bagel, and I haven’t looked back since.

This place is a little slice of neighborhood magic—and once you go, you’ll understand why it’s loved by so many. There's only so many seats, so don't be surprised if you have to...

Bagels on Fire is basically the lunch time sponsor for us LMAO.

The women who work here are all so wonderful (there's no AC, and it gets STEAMY in there - the fact that they're still so nice is a miracle), and sometimes you get a bagel that you can literally taste the love. Once in awhile you'll get a foamy tomato, or a bagel with kind of funky ingredient distribution, but those are outliers.

They're a wonderful part of the neighbourhood, and they're the first place I send people when they ask about food around here. I usually grab the BLT with cheddar cheese, and sometimes a salmon lox bagel. If you get the cinnamon puff, ask them to warm it up for you - definitely improves the taste! I cannot sing their praises enough, and the people who work there honestly make...

Highly rated when i searched up a good bagel spot while in Toronto so i decided to check it out. Staff were friendly and upon impression, seemed like it was going to live up to its rating on Google. I ordered the breakfast bagel since I came here in the am and needed some food in me. Didnt take long to prepare my bagel and once i got it, I was underwhelmed. Very thin bagel when it came to the toppings. I've had better looking bagels sandwiches at McDonald's if I'm being honest. The taste wasn't that great either. Again, better tasting bagel sandwiches at McDonald's which pains me to say and admit. Overall, i wouldn't come back and not sure if the people who rated it so highly have ever tried other bagel shops before giving this rating.

Bagels On Fire has been around for just over a decade but somehow escaped my notice until recently. They sell Montreal-style bagels, which tend to be a bit sweeter and denser than traditional Toronto-style. We ordered tuna salad sandwiches. The bagel itself was fine, although the outer layer of mine had a toasted consistency. I'm not sure if it was toasted or not but I definitely didn't want it toasted so I wasn't a fan of the texture regardless. The tuna salad was decent — not my favourite in town but well seasoned, and I enjoyed that the sandwich had a few other ingredients too (tomato slice, etc). Overall it was pretty good. There are only so many places to find Montreal-style bagels downtown, so I appreciate having another option.

I bought these bagels to "round out" a charcuterie-style lunch with friends and they ended up stealing the entire show. The chewy outer was the perfect companion to the soft, buttery bagel inner. Every one raved about the texture. We ate them with smoked salmon. We ate them with their homemade cream cheese. We ate them with Nutella. We ate them with brie. We couldn't STOP eating them they were so delicious. Four of us ate all eight bagels I bought in one sitting. If you get a chance to stop by in the morning, do it! My takeout bag was still steamy from that morning's wood fired batch making the entire experience all that much better. I'm a fan. And I'll be back.
